Members of the Healthcare Leadership Council believe unequivocally that continued healthcare innovation is critical to achieving a healthcare system that is more efficient, more accessible, more effective and of the highest quality. Whether it’s convening initiatives to forge consensus on innovation-focused issues or demonstrating new medical breakthroughs to lawmakers, HLC focuses its activities on the importance of innovation to the future of American healthcare.
